The Cherry Springs route begins and ends at Beach Lot #2 near Lake Jean in Ricketts Glen State Park. From the trailhead, follow the red-blazed Mountain Springs Trail as it heads south and then east through a quiet hemlock forest. Just beyond the remains of the old Lake Leigh Dam, stay left at the junction and continue onto Cherry Run Trail.
The trail gradually descends toward Cherry Run, offering a remote feel and a peaceful alternative to the park’s busier waterfall routes. Continue past small cascades and mossy streambedsbefore reaching a signed junction with Little Cherry Run Trail. Turn right here and follow the path through a scenic section of boulders and rock formations nestled beneath the forest canopy. After a short distance, the trail connects with Mountain Springs Trail—turn right again and follow it back through rolling terrain toward Lake Jean. This moderate day hike in Ricketts Glen combines solitude, forest scenery, and streamside walking in one of the park’s quieter corners.
